Stayed up way too late watching that UIW at Sacramento St game. The Hornets had 738 yards of offense, 49 first downs, and were successful on 2 onside kicks and still lost. UIW's final 4 touchdown drives were a combined 16 plays and took 3:57. Just a bonkers game that would have been at home in Arena Football.
